DEE476800076 is the International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) for the recording "Kantate "Non sà che sia dolore", BWV 209: Parti pur col dolore" by Elly Ameling, Collegium Aureum, Franzjosef Maier, released 1990-01-01. ISRCs are 12-character ISO 3901 identifiers that uniquely tag a specific sound recording — different masters, remixes, and live versions each receive a distinct ISRC.

DEE476800076 is an International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) that uniquely identifies the recording "Kantate "Non sà che sia dolore", BWV 209: Parti pur col dolore" by Elly Ameling, Collegium Aureum, Franzjosef Maier. ISRCs are 12-character alphanumeric codes defined by ISO 3901, used globally by streaming platforms, record labels, and rights organizations to track plays and distribute royalties.
